Rengsdorf (dpa / lrs) - Three police officers were slightly injured during a deployment in Rengsdorf in Rhineland-Palatinate (Neuwied district).

As the police announced on Sunday, the officers had been called to an alleged brawl with several people on Saturday evening.

On the way there was another message that those involved had piled up in a vehicle.

The police officers parked the vehicle in Rengsdorf.

Two of the men fled between the ages of 32 and 31.

When they were subsequently arrested, the police said they offered “considerable resistance by being beaten and kicked”.

A police officer was hit in the face with his fist.

The police used a taser.

It was only possible to arrest the men with several emergency services.

When the vehicle was searched, large quantities of narcotics were found.

The 40-year-old driver also does not have a valid driver's license.

In addition, the officials determined that he had "typical drug deficits".

Blood samples were taken from all three men.

Criminal proceedings have been initiated against them.
